An asteroid with a diameter of 11km and a mass of 4.3 x 1015 kg impacts the earth at a speed of 31414m/s, landing in the Pacific Ocean. If 1.23% of the asteroid's kinetic energy goes to boiling the ocean water (assume an initial water temperature of 12°C), what volume of ocean water in L) will be boiled away by the collision? Assume ocean water is just plain water.
